When it comes to barcades, they don’t get much better than this. Like Add-A-Ball in Seattle and Quarterworld in Portland, it’s a fun place to waste an afternoon with just the right amount of nerdiness.
They have a full bar but the games are the star here and it’s set up accordingly with machines across both walls (I counted 24 on a recent visit). The staff is friendly and the drinks (including a rotating slushee) are reasonably priced. It’s beginner-friendly and the male/female ratio approaches 50/50.
